Physics FAQ

What topics are typically covered in physics tutoring?

Physics tutoring generally covers a range of topics including mechanics (motion, energy, and force), thermodynamics (heat and temperature), electromagnetism (electricity and magnetism), waves and vibrations (sound and light), and modern physics (relativity and quantum mechanics). Sessions can be tailored to focus on specific areas of interest or difficulty, and can also include practical experiments and problem-solving techniques.

How can physics tutoring help improve my grade?

Physics tutoring can help improve your grade by providing personalized instruction and clarification on complex concepts. A tutor can offer different perspectives on subjects, provide practice problems to enhance understanding, and help develop effective study and problem-solving strategies. Additionally, tutoring sessions can build confidence and address any gaps in knowledge, leading to better performance on exams.

Is online physics tutoring as effective as in-person tutoring?

Online physics tutoring can be just as effective as in-person tutoring with the right tools and approach. It offers flexibility, access to a wider range of tutors, and interactive tools such as virtual whiteboards and simulations. Success depends on the student's learning style, the quality of the tutor, and the level of interaction during the sessions. For many students, the convenience of online tutoring makes it a preferable option.

What qualifications should a physics tutor have?

A qualified physics tutor should have a strong background in physics, usually evidenced by at least a bachelor's degree in the subject or a related field. Additionally, they should have a proven track record of tutoring or teaching experience. Good communication skills, patience, and the ability to explain complex concepts in an accessible manner are also critical qualifications for an effective physics tutor.

How long does it usually take to see improvement with physics tutoring?

The time it takes to see improvement with physics tutoring can vary depending on the student's initial level of understanding, the complexity of the topics, and the frequency of tutoring sessions. Most students may begin to notice improvements within a few weeks of consistent tutoring. Regular practice and engagement with the material outside of tutoring sessions can also accelerate progress.

About Ocean Ridge, FL And It’s Education Institutions

Ocean Ridge, Florida, a small coastal town nestled along the eastern edge of Palm Beach County, boasts a tranquil atmosphere distinctive for its picturesque beaches and serene environment. Historically, the town was incorporated in 1931 and has maintained a low-density, residential character with a current population hovering around 1,700 residents. Among the notable landmarks is the Ocean Ridge Natural Area, an environmental preserve that provides educational opportunities and a glimpse into the native Florida ecosystems.

Education in Ocean Ridge is serviced by the Palm Beach County School District, but the town does not host its own public schools. Local families typically send their children to nearby top-ranked public K-12 schools, such as A-rated Suncoast Community High School and Bak Middle School of the Arts. For those seeking private education, Saint Vincent Ferrer School is a highly regarded choice. While there are no universities within Ocean Ridge itself, higher education institutions are accessible in the neighboring cities, providing a range of options for residents pursuing university-level degrees.

Students residing in Ocean Ridge have access to a plethora of education resources, including the Ocean Ridge Public Library and nearby civic centers offering after-school programs and tutoring services. The town is part of a larger network of academic support through partnerships with local organizations and nearby education institutions. About Physics & Physics Tutoring

Physics, a term coined from the Greek word "physis" meaning nature, is the natural science that studies matter, its fundamental constituents, its motion and behavior through space and time, and the related entities of energy and force. It aims to understand the universe and its phenomena at the most fundamental level, providing a basis for all other natural sciences.

Physics inherently scrutinizes the cosmos from the grandest galaxies to the tiniest subatomic particles. Its core principles lay the groundwork for everything from the technology shaping our modern world, to the theoretical frameworks that define our understanding of reality.

There are several branches of physics which often overlap with one another, including classical mechanics, quantum mechanics, thermodynamics, electromagnetism, and relativity. Each branch covers different aspects of physical behavior. Classical mechanics, for example, deals with the motion of objects that are relatively large and slow-moving compared to the speed of light. In contrast, quantum mechanics is essential for understanding the behavior of particles at the atomic and subatomic levels.

Related entities to physics encompass a broad spectrum. At its core are fundamental forces—the gravitational, electromagnetic, weak, and strong interactions—which govern the interactions between particles. Surrounding these are entities such as energy, fields, space-time, and quantum states, which are indispensable in our description of natural phenomena.

Tutoring physics effectively requires a strategic approach, particularly for learners who find the subject challenging. Begin by assessing the student's current level of understanding and any misconceptions they may have. From there, present concepts in a gradual, systematic manner. Use real-world examples and demonstrations to relate abstract principles to familiar experiences. Additionally, encourage critical thinking and problem-solving by working through plenty of practice problems. Above all, fostering a patience-based learning environment where students are comfortable asking questions and making mistakes is crucial.

In physics, some of the most common concepts include Newton's laws of motion, which provide a foundation for classical mechanics, and the conservation laws, such as the conservation of energy and momentum. Other central principles include Ohm's law in electromagnetism and the principle of wave-particle duality in quantum mechanics.

Among the most challenging concepts in physics are those in quantum mechanics, such as wavefunction superposition and entanglement, and those in relativity, like the warping of space-time near massive objects. These concepts are mathematically complex and often non-intuitive, as they defy everyday experiences and require an abstract understanding.

Effective learning in physics not only relies on comprehending these concepts but also on the ability to mathematically describe and predict the outcomes of physical situations. This dual demand of conceptual understanding and mathematical proficiency can make physics a difficult subject, but with deliberate practice and thoughtful instruction, students can build both their knowledge base and their problem-solving skills.
